First class site

Our first visit to this site for a long-weekend and we certainly weren't disappointed. Facilities were modern, spotlessly clean and very well maintained. The site is lovely and quiet and in easy walking distance of Forfar town centre, local supermarkets and pubs.  The loch with its variety of wild fowl made for pleasant dog walk at this time of year. There's plenty to see and do in the area, Olympia Swimming pool and flumes in Dundee (great for kids and young-at-heart-adults), Glamis Castle and grounds to name only two. If I could change anything about the site, I would put a footpath across the grass to the toilet block but other than that I would say it was near perfect. Will definitely return for a longer stay.
